THE ROLE
As an Experienced Vehicle Damage Assessor (VDA) / Estimator, you will be responsible for accurately assessing vehicle damage, preparing detailed repair estimates, and managing repairs from initial inspection through to completion. Working closely with technicians, insurers, engineers, and customers, you will ensure every repair is completed efficiently while maintaining exceptional quality and customer sat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ities
·Inspect accident-damaged vehicles and prepare accurate repair estimates using industry-recognised estimating systems.
·Assess vehicle damage in accordance with manufacturer repair methods and insurance guidelines.
·Liaise with customers, insurers, engineers, and internal workshop teams throughout the repair process.
·Identify repair methods, replacement parts, and labour requirements to ensure accurate costings.
·Monitor repair progress and authorise supplementary estimates where required.
·Work closely with Workshop Controllers, Panel Technicians, MET Technicians, and Paint Technicians to maximise workshop efficiency.
·Ensure all repairs comply with manufacturer standards, quality procedures, and Health & Safety regulations.
·Deliver exceptional customer service by providing regular updates and managing customer expectations throughout the repair journey.
ABOUT YOU
We're looking for an experienced, organised, and customer-focused Vehicle Damage Assessor who thrives in a busy accident repair environment and has a passion for delivering outstanding customer service and accurate vehicle assessments.
You will ideally have:
·Previous experience as a Vehicle Damage Assessor (VDA), Bodyshop Estimator, or Vehicle Estimator within an automotive accident repair centre.
·ATA Accreditation in Vehicle Damage Assessing (advantageous but not essential).
·Experience using estimating systems such as Audatex, GT Motive, or AutoFlow.
·Strong understanding of modern vehicle construction, repair techniques, and manufacturer repair methods.
·Excellent communication and customer service skills with the ability to build strong relationships.
·High levels of accuracy and attention to detail when preparing repair estimates.
·Ability to prioritise workload and work effectively in a fast-paced environment.
·Full UK Driving Licence preferred.
